GENERAL PROVISIONS
Entitlement and Computation of Inactive Duty Training Pay and Special Pay
A. Inactive Duty Training With Pay. A member of the National Guard or a Reserve Component is entitled to compensation at the rate of one-thirtieth of the basic pay prescribed for grade and years of service for the performance of each authorized period of:
1. Regular inactive duty training (drill or unit training assembly).
2. Equivalent training, instruction, or duty.
a. Army: For details and exceptions, see Army Regulation 140-1 and National Guard Regulation 350-1.
b. Navy: See Bureau of Navy Personnel Instruction 1001.39 Series.
c. Air Force: See Air National Guard Instruction 36-2001 and Air Force Instructions 36-2254 V1.
d. Marine Corps: See Marine Corps Order P1001R.1K.
3. Appropriate duty.
4. Additional flying training period (AFTP).
5. Additional inactive duty training.
6. Duty or training that resulted in the successful completion of a course of instruction undertaken by the member using electronically distributed learning methodologies to accomplish training requirements related to unit readiness or mobilization, as directed for the member by the Secretary concerned.
NOTE: To qualify for pay for a period of inactive duty training, each member shall engage in such duty or training for the period (not less than 2 hours) as prescribed by the Secretary concerned. Compensation will not accrue for periods of inactive duty performed in excess of the number authorized by the appropriate regulations of the Military Service concerned. A member cannot qualify for pay for more than two periods of inactive duty training during a single calendar day.
B. Inactive Duty Training Without Pay. Members of the Reserve Components may, with their consent, be ordered to inactive duty training without pay when authorized by the Secretary concerned.
C. Combination Active Duty and Inactive Duty. A member of a Reserve Component may be paid the equivalent total of pay for more than 360 days in a year, when so directed based on actual entitlement if the total is based on a combination of active duty pay and inactive duty training compensation.
